RoutePolicy.sys is a critical system file in Windows operating systems. Essentially, it is responsible for managing the routing policies on the system. This includes controlling how network traffic is routed between different networks and interfaces.
If this file becomes corrupted or encounters errors, it can lead to network connectivity issues and other related problems on the computer. Understanding the function of RoutePolicy.sys is crucial for troubleshooting network-related issues on Windows devices.

Update Your Device Drivers
How to update device drivers on your PC. Occasionally, RoutePolicy.sys errors can be attributed to incompatible drivers.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Device Manager
in the search bar and press Enter.
-
In the Device Manager window, locate the device whose driver you want to update.
-
Click on the arrow or plus sign next to the device category to expand it.
-
Right-click on the device and select Update driver.
-
In the next window, select Search automatically for updated driver software.
-
Follow the prompts to install the driver update.
